Transaction 34baf584669ca0bc2458d9a87f2e5c6260e84b303febcc1e191ad568b918739d

8 Input
2 Outputs
  • 34baf584669ca0bc2458d9a87f2e5c6260e84b303febcc1e191ad568b918739d:0
  • value  23404
    address  19Jf7SYpAu51tTbJsKSJLBmwrA8RFcU5L4
  • 34baf584669ca0bc2458d9a87f2e5c6260e84b303febcc1e191ad568b918739d:1
  • value  932976
    address  1Aza8UqD6R5EY9PFEkwKNevCQFTuwA939f